Charpentier’s masterpiece David et Jonathas premieres at the Teatro Real, performed by the instrumental and vocal group Ensemble Correspondances, led by Sébastien Daucé. An opera that captivates the heart and soul through the fascinating biblical story of the friendship between King David and Jonathan, son of Saul.
Tragédie biblique in five acts with a prologue
Music by Marc-Antoine Charpentier (1643-1704)
Libretto by François Bretonneau
Premiered at Collège Louis-le-Grand in París on 28th February 1688
